Subject: [PATCH] bluez4/5: Add EXCLUDE_FROM_WORLD = 1
Date: Wed, 11 Sep 2013 14:38:01 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1378935481-592-1-git-send-email-sgw@linux.intel.com> (raw)
We can't build both recipes in the world build as there is a collision of package name
and PR values. Specificly the libasound-module-bluez which is the same in both goes
backwards from r5 (bluez4) -> r0 (bluez5) and the subpackage_metadata check fails:
ERROR: Recipe lib32-bluez5 is trying to change PR from 'r0' to 'r5'. This will cause do_package_write_* failures since the incorrect data will be used and they will be unable to find the right workdir.
[YOCTO #5165]

meta/recipes-connectivity/bluez/bluez4.inc | 1 +
meta/recipes-connectivity/bluez5/bluez5.inc | 2 ++
2 files changed, 3 insertions(+)
diff --git a/meta/recipes-connectivity/bluez/bluez4.inc b/meta/recipes-connectivity/bluez/bluez4.inc
index b540622..e4f6834 100644
--- a/meta/recipes-connectivity/bluez/bluez4.inc
+++ b/meta/recipes-connectivity/bluez/bluez4.inc
@@ -43,3 +43,4 @@ EXTRA_OECONF = "\
--with-udevrulesdir=`pkg-config --variable=udevdir udev`/rules.d \
"
+EXCLUDE_FROM_WORLD = "1"
diff --git a/meta/recipes-connectivity/bluez5/bluez5.inc b/meta/recipes-connectivity/bluez5/bluez5.inc
index e5cb9e8..2e25d86 100644
--- a/meta/recipes-connectivity/bluez5/bluez5.inc
+++ b/meta/recipes-connectivity/bluez5/bluez5.inc
@@ -82,3 +82,5 @@ FILES_${PN}-dbg += "\
RDEPENDS_${PN}-testtools += "python python-dbus python-pygobject"
SYSTEMD_SERVICE_${PN} = "bluetooth.service"
+
+EXCLUDE_FROM_WORLD = "1"
